Product details

2:1 power mux for dual-supply handoff

The TPS2115APW is a source selector switch from Texas Instruments that routes one of two input supplies to a single output, controlled by a logic pin. It integrates an N-channel FET per input, so no external pass transistor is needed. The 2:1 input-to-output ratio means the part selects between two power rails — typical in handheld and mobile devices where a battery and a USB or adapter supply share the load. The 1.25 A continuous output ceiling suits moderate-load peripherals, sensors, and radio modules that draw under 1 A steady-state.

55 µA quiescent — always-on budget matters

The 55 µA supply current is the current the selector itself burns while active. The 1 ms turn-on delay and 5 ms turn-off delay prevent glitches during supply transitions, which is useful when the switchover happens under load.

What is the difference between TPS2115APW and TPS2115APWR?

The TPS2115APW ships in a Tube, while the TPS2115APWR ships in Tape & Reel. The silicon and package are identical.
